The height of a cone is 15 cm .If its volume is 1570cm, find the radius of the base​

Given:

Volume of a cone= 1570 cm³

Height of a cone = 15 cm

Radius of the base = ❓

Let the radius of base of the cone be r cm

Formula to find the volume of the cone is

\frac{1}{3} πr^2h

By substituting the given values in the formula, we get...

\frac{1}{3} πr^2h. = 1570

\frac{1}{3} × 3.14 × r^2×15 = 1570

\frac{1}{3} × 3.14 ×15 × r^2 = 1570

15.7 × r^2= 1570

r^2 = \frac{1570}{15.7}

r^2= 100

r = √100

r = {\boxed{\boxed{10cm}}}

•°• Radius of the base of the cone is 10 cm
